Alloa Athletic vs Raith Rovers preview - Duo back for Alloa
Posted Friday, August 15, 2014 by PA
Alloa start their home games in the Championship with a visit from Raith Rovers and manager Barry Smith has defenders Jonathan Tiffoney and Mark Docherty available after suspension.
The attack-minded David Weatherston and Eddie Ferns have returned to training, however a lack of match practice will see them miss out.
Smith said: "We played well at Queen of the South, but we gave goals away and never took our chances. That is a dangerous combination and we lost 2-0.
"If we can improve in these two areas then we can get something from this game. Raith have good strikers, however we have players that can hurt them."
Raith will again be without injured defenders Dougie Hill (groin) and Craig Barr (knee), though Calum Elliot has a chance of playing, despite picking up a knock in their 3-1 success over Dumbarton last weekend.
Manager Grant Murray knows his men that they will need to be wary of the Wasps.
"Alloa are at home and they will see this as a crucial game to win. We managed to get a goal in front in our game last weekend, however before that Dumbarton had chances.
"Alloa lost to Queen of the South in similar circumstances and that shows how crucial the opening goal can be."
